A Baldur's Gate 2 remake may already be underway, according to a new report. This Baldur's Gate 2 remake could bring players who started the series with Baldur's Gate 3 an opportunity to experience to the earlier titles, but with a more modern experience.
Baldur's Gate 3 took the gaming world by storm, selling millions of copies, earning tons of awards, and generally put Baldur's Gate on the map for a new generation of gamers. With 25 years separating the release of the original Baldur's Gate and Baldur's Gate 3, there are many who had likely never heard of the series, but now are eager to explore more of what the franchise has to offer.

According to a new report, a remake of Baldur's Gate 2 is already in development. The news came via PC Gamer, which didn't share its source, but seemed confident in the details.
